Nathanael
Boy name · #632 in 2025 · Uniqueness 49/100
Nathanael ranks #632 among American boys' names as of 2025, with 442 newborns given the name that year. A decade ago it stood at #580, so the name has been falling over the past ten years. Roughly one in every 4,072 boys born in 2025 was named Nathanael.

The 110-year story
Nathanael first appears in the Social Security records in 1915, when 6 boys received the name. Its peak came in 2000, when 609 boys were named Nathanael — good for #408 that year. Where Nathanael is most common
Geography matters for names, and Nathanael is no exception. In 2025 the states with the most Nathanaels were CA (64), TX (60), FL (38), GA (26), NY (24). Raw counts naturally favor populous states, but the spread still hints at where the name is part of the local naming culture.

Rank history (last 25 years)
| Year | Babies named Nathanael | Rank |
|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 442 | #632 |
| 2024 | 407 | #674 |
| 2023 | 369 | #719 |
| 2022 | 325 | #777 |
| 2021 | 317 | #780 |
| 2020 | 345 | #718 |
| 2019 | 348 | #710 |
| 2018 | 337 | #717 |
| 2017 | 402 | #644 |
| 2016 | 431 | #621 |
| 2015 | 480 | #580 |
| 2014 | 477 | #582 |
| 2013 | 471 | #557 |
| 2012 | 438 | #584 |
| 2011 | 433 | #579 |
| 2010 | 475 | #538 |
| 2009 | 586 | #466 |
| 2008 | 531 | #513 |
| 2007 | 598 | #462 |
| 2006 | 594 | #455 |
| 2005 | 577 | #448 |
| 2004 | 595 | #435 |
| 2003 | 539 | #466 |
| 2002 | 539 | #454 |
| 2001 | 544 | #446 |
